In Leviticus 23, God re-orders Israel’s time in such a way that reinforces the spiritual realities they are to live out. He establishes weekly and annual rhythms for them by giving them a suite of holy days. Even though Israel’s holy days are not our holy days, there are timeless principles embedded in this chapter which help us to order our time well, and establish good rhythms in our lives.
